Join us as the Senior Vice President of Philanthropic Strategy, where you will play a crucial role in steering our fundraising efforts to ensure the long-term sustainability of our mission. In this position, you will craft and implement a comprehensive fundraising plan aligned with HumanGood's strategic objectives. Your expertise will be instrumental in diversifying our donor base, securing funding for innovative initiatives, and maintaining support for existing programs.
Your responsibilities will include :
- Leading the development of a long-term fundraising strategy that secures the Foundation's sustainability.
- Establishing performance metrics and collaborating with the Leadership Team and Board(s) to evaluate our fundraising effectiveness.
- Engaging Board(s) and the Foundation team in fund development initiatives while clearly delineating their roles.
- Building and executing a fundraising plan that supports our five-year strategic vision.
- Collaborating with the Leadership Team to optimize revenue opportunities and secure seed funding for innovative projects.
- Crafting a compelling message of impact to motivate partners to invest in our mission.
- Managing a portfolio of major gifts, including multi-year commitments from individuals, foundations, and corporations.
- Working closely with the Chief Operating and Financial Officers to develop and oversee the Foundation's fundraising budgets.
- Creating reports that track progress and strategically adapt plans as needed.
- Ensuring our donor management system is effective and utilized to support development goals.
- Establishing key processes for building strategic partnerships with donors and funders.
- Ensuring compliance with regulations, accountability standards, and ethical principles in fundraising.
- Overseeing the stewardship of endowments to maintain long-term relationships with donors.
